About Paul‐Anton Will

Paul‐Anton Will is a scholar working on Electrical and Electronic Engineering, Polymers and Plastics and Materials Chemistry, having authored 21 papers that have together received 517 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Organic Light-Emitting Diodes Research (19 papers), Organic Electronics and Photovoltaics (17 papers) and Conducting polymers and applications (5 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Polymers and Plastics (93 citations), Electrical and Electronic Engineering (328 citations) and Materials Chemistry (189 citations). Paul‐Anton Will has collaborated with scholars based in Germany, Slovenia and Slovakia. Frequent co-authors include Sebastian Reineke, Simone Lenk, Christian Hänisch, Axel Fischer, Joan Ràfols‐Ribé, Marta González-Silveira, J. Rodríguez‐Viejo, Reinhard Scholz, Brigitte Voit and Karl Leo. Their work appears in journals such as Angewandte Chemie International Edition, Nature Communications and Journal of Applied Physics.
